Tema de cercetare: "Scan statistics si aplicatii"
se desfasoara in cadrul programului "BRANCUSI" de colaborare Romano-Franceza de catre Colectivul de Cercetare in Informatica, condus de Prof.dr. I.Vaduva.
Colaborarea se realizeaza intre Centrul de cercetari in Informatica medicala (CERIM) al Universitatii Lille2 si Colectivul de cercetare in Informatica al Facultatii de Matematica si Informatica, Universitatea din Bucuresti.
Colaborarea se desfasoara pe anii 2005 - 2006. Partea franceza studiaza aproximari ale statisticii scan bidimensionale. Partea romana studiaza estimarea repartitiei statisticii scan pentru un domeniu plan in care punctele sunt generate de un proces Poisson bidimensional uniform.
In final se va obtine un test din care se verifica daca incidenta geografica a unei boli (intr-un teritoriu) este aleatoare (si deci normala!), sau este determinata de cauze ce ar trebui investigate.
O aplicatie practica se va realiza cu date furnizate de partea franceza din zona geografica Lille.
Tema face parte din planul intern al FMI si este finantata partial de MEC.
